-->

How to Start a Blog and Rank on Google: A Complete Guide for Beginners and Experts

How to Start a Blog and Rank on Google: A Complete Guide for Beginners and Experts


Table of Contents

How To Start A Blog

  • Identify your passions and expertise.
  • Research demand is sourced from Google Trends and AnswerThePublic.
  • Check out blogs that are highly competitive in your area of expertise.

Your domain name forms the part of your blog's online identity, so pick a domain name that is short, memorable, and reflects your niche. Once you have a domain, select the best hosting for your site. How does it work?

  • Best Hosting Platform For Bloggers:
  • Bluehost: Easiest for new users with inexpensive hosting and one-click WordPress setup.

SiteGround: One of the best for speed and security, superb customer support

What could be better than starting a blog to promote, get more followers, and also make money online? However, simply creating a blog is not enough; you must publish it for your audience. The way to get there is through ranking on Google and the right strategies and tools you need to accomplish that.

1: Pick your blog niche.

Isn’t that the cliché of blogging — find a niche? You are focusing your content on specific topics, thus making it a specialized niche for you, which helps you grow. To choose a niche:

Step 2: Choosing your domain name and hosting site.

  1. HostGator: Budget-friendly with scalable options for growing blogs.
  2. Kinsta: Premium hosting with exceptional performance for advanced users. 

Step 3: Set Up Your Blog

Step 4: Create High-Quality Content

Step 5: Optimize for SEO

Most bloggers use WordPress because of its flexibility and ease in using it. After obtaining your hosting, you can add WordPress and then use a theme to customize the appearance of your blog. Popular WordPress themes include:

  • Astra: lightweight and customizable.

  • GeneratePress: Great for speed and simplicity.

  • Divi: Perfect for creative control with a drag-and-drop builder.

Google prioritizes content that is valuable, relevant, and engaging. Follow these tips to create quality blog posts:

  • Write in-depth articles (1,500+ words) covering your topic comprehensively.

  • Use a conversational tone to connect with readers.

  • Include images, videos, and infographics to enhance engagement.

  • Optimize for readability with short paragraphs and subheadings.

Search Engine Optimization (SEO) helps your blog rank higher on Google. Here's how to implement SEO effectively:

  1. Keyword Research: Use tools like Ahrefs, SEMrush, or Google Keyword Planner to find low-competition keywords relevant to your niche.

  2. On-Page SEO:

    • Include your target keyword in the title, headings, and URL.

    • Write a compelling meta description.

    • Use internal and external links.

    • Optimize images with descriptive file names and alt text.

  3. Technical SEO:

    • Ensure your site is mobile-friendly.

    • Improve page speed using tools like GTmetrix or Pingdom.

    • Set up an XML sitemap and submit it to Google Search Console.

  4. Content Strategy:

    • Regularly update old posts.

    • Write pillar content (in-depth, evergreen posts) to establish authority.

    • Create topic clusters by interlinking related posts.


Best SEO Tools for Bloggers

  1. Ahrefs: Comprehensive tool for keyword research, backlink analysis, and site audits.

  2. SEMrush: All-in-one platform for SEO, PPC, and competitor analysis.

  3. Yoast SEO: WordPress plugin for on-page SEO optimization.

  4. Google Analytics: tracks traffic, user behavior, and performance metrics.

  5. Moz: Excellent for keyword research and site audits.

Step 6: Promote Your Blog
Step 7: Monitor and Improve Performance

After publishing content, promote it to drive traffic and improve your Google rankings:

  • Social Media: Share your posts on platforms like Facebook, Twitter, and Pinterest.

  • Email Marketing: Build an email list to notify subscribers of new content.

  • Guest Blogging: Write for other sites in your niche to build backlinks and authority.

  • Engage with Communities: Participate in forums and groups where your audience hangs out.

Track your blog’s performance to identify what works and what needs improvement:

  • Use Google Analytics and Search Console to monitor traffic, keywords, and indexing.

  • Analyze competitor strategies with tools like Ahrefs and SEMrush.

  • Regularly optimize underperforming content by updating keywords and improving readability.


Final Thoughts.

It takes a little consistency, a little effort and the correct tools … and you will be blogging and climbing that google rank in no time! The only way to achieve success online is to not waste time, concentrate on your blog, and get an audience by timely selection of a niche, an appropriate hosting service provider, content creation, and eventually SEO optimization. This book has everything you need to be a pro — whether you’re the aspiring amateur or the pro who wants the edge in their strategy.

Cookies Consent

This website uses cookies to offer you a better Browsing Experience. By using our website, You agree to the use of Cookies

Learn More